Elizabeth North Plumstead (later Mrs. William Elliot) is a work by British artist John Wollaston (ca. 1710 - 1775). It's one portrait oil on canvas painting created in 1758. The painting is owned by Fine Arts Museums of San Francisco - Legion of Honor, and is accessible to the general public. John Wollaston made most paintings about portrait and figure and tableau.
